Quote:
Originally Posted by Nighthawk89 View Post
I know. Im looking for something stronger over stock... want to reduce slippage.
We will be using a tensioner that is very similar to the one included in the Lingenfelter 10-rib kit. Two reasons: upgraded tension over stock, and we will provide the part number with our kit so anyone who needs to replace it can get one from Autozone/Advance/O'Reilly if there is an issue.

What overdrive % balancer balancer is recommended? Im still researching this subject..
Nighthawk89 is offline   Reply With Quote
Old 03-02-2015, 01:44 AM   #11
2012LS3VERT

 
Drives: 2012 2SSRS Vert, Black w/M6
Join Date: Jan 2013
Location: Montgomery, AL
Posts: 1,265
We will be running a 10% overdrive. This allows for the largest possible blower pulley for the best belt contact.
